If –3 i is a root of the polynomial function f(x), which of the following must also be a root of f(x)? –3 – i –3i 3 – i 3i
Ber [7]

If -3 + i is a root of the polynomial function f(x), -3 - i must also be a root of f(x)

<h3>How to determine the true statement?</h3>

The root of the polynomial function is given as:

-3 + i

The above root is a complex root.

If a polynomial has a complex root, then the conjugate of the root is also a root of the function

The conjugate of -3 + i is -3 - i

Hence, if -3 + i is a root of the polynomial function f(x), -3 - i must also be a root of f(x)
